Ingredients
Scale
Main Ingredients:
- 4 pork chops (bone-in or boneless, about 1 inch thick)
- 1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ese
- 1/2 cup panko breadcrumbs
Seasoning Ingredients:
- 1 tablespoon garlic powder
- 1 teaspoon onion powder
- 1 teaspoon smoked paprika
- Salt and pepper to taste
Binding and Cooking Ingredients:
- 1 large egg, beaten
- 1/4 cup milk
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
Instructions
- Warm the oven to 375°F, preparing a welcoming environment for the culinary creation.
- Craft a flavor-packed coating by blending Parmesan, garlic powder, paprika, minced garlic, and breadcrumbs with a delicate touch of salt and pepper.
- Massage pork chops with olive oil, ensuring each surface is generously embraced by the aromatic seasoning mixture.
- Position the seasoned pork chops in a baking dish, allowing them to transform in the oven’s consistent heat for 20-25 minutes.
- Verify doneness by checking the internal temperature, which should reach a perfect 145°F, indicating juicy and safe-to-eat meat.
- While the pork chops rest, gently sprinkle fresh parsley across the surface for a vibrant, herbaceous finish.
- Plate the golden-crusted pork chops alongside creamy scalloped potatoes, creating a harmonious and inviting meal presentation.
Notes
- Swap breadcrumbs with almond flour for a gluten-free version that maintains a crispy coating on the pork chops.
- Use bone-in pork chops for extra juiciness and richer flavor, ensuring they’re evenly thick for consistent cooking.
- Let pork chops rest for 5-10 minutes after baking to help retain moisture and prevent drying out during serving.
- Choose low-fat cheese and milk alternatives for a lighter version of the scalloped potatoes without compromising taste.
